In August 2019, a class-action lawsuit was filed against Cali Bamboo for allegedly misleadingly marketing that its bamboo flooring is durable, meets industry standards, and lasts for 50 years when, according to plaintiffs, the flooring prematurely cracks, splits, warps, and shrinks and does not last 50 years. (Klaehn et al v. Cali Bamboo, LLC, Case No. 19-cv-1498, S. D. CA.)
